Mighter Than The Waves
For me the Ocean is one of God’s mightiest creations. I LOVE the sea. Nonetheless, I don’t like swimming in it. Sharks, stinging Jelly fish, snappy crabs and other creatures although magnificent handiwork’s, are all cause for concern. As far as I’m concerned the West Edmonton Mall water park with its fake wave pool is a much safer and desirable place for swimming.
But to sit on a sand dune and to listen to the roar of the crashing waves or to walk barefoot upon the sand on the water’s edge while the waves pound the shore … it’s exhilarating beyond description! At times I quietly sat and observed with a revered respect the majesty of the ocean. I sensed God speaking to me directly. In fact it was the result of such intimate moments that lead me to write a song based on Psalm 93.
While we lived in New Zealand we had the opportunity to experience the beauty and the majesty of the ocean on a regular basis. We collected shells, made sand castles, ran up and down sand dunes and breathed in the crisp sea breeze. We lived only 20 minutes away from the nearest beach. According to the locals it was not the greatest beach and 20 minutes was too far to drive.
But for us Canadians who would have to drive at least 18 hours (in Canada) to get to the nearest beach, our beach in New Zealand was truly Paradise on Earth. It’s amazing how one’s perspective can be so different, depending upon life experiences.
While many locals take the ocean for granted, we made use of every opportunity to enjoy it! No doubt God delights in us enjoying not only his creation but more importantly His fellowship with every given opportunity. Indeed our God is mightier than the seas … the nature of his reign is firmly established … it cannot be shaken … the nature of his reign is holiness forever.
